Engineering DirectorThe Director of Engineering will lead the design and development of next-generation MBG products while building a strong, engaged engineering team. This role is responsible for driving a focused, execution-oriented development organization that delivers high-quality boats to market on time and ready for production.Maverick Boat Group is known for building top-tier fishing boats across its portfolio of brands, including Maverick, Hewes, Pathfinder, and Cobia. This role plays a key part in continuing that standard by ensuring our products reflect both strong Engineering fundamentals and a clear understanding of how customers actually use our boats on the water.This leader will strengthen MBG's in-house product development capability, improve how engineering partners with production, and help raise the bar on product quality, performance, and execution.We are looking for someone who is not just a strong engineering leader, but someone who genuinely cares about the marine industry.

This role requires a real connection to boats, time on the water, and an understanding of what matters to the customer.Top PrioritiesLead the design and development of next-generation MBG productsSupport production, quality, and customer service through strong engineering executionBuild a high-performing engineering team and cultureKey ResponsibilitiesLead product development from concept through production launch across the MBG portfolioDrive execution against defined program milestones, schedules, and deliverablesBalance innovation with practicality, delivering products that perform on the water and execute cleanly in productionProvide clear direction on product development priorities based on customer use, market awareness, and business needsBuild, develop, and lead a high-performing engineering teamEstablish clear expectations, ownership, and accountability across all projectsAssess current team capabilities and strengthen the team where neededCreate an environment where engineers are engaged, challenged, and take pride in the products they deliverEnsure designs are built for manufacturability, repeatability, and qualityImprove how engineering hands off work to production with clear documentation and stronger definitionWork closely with operations to ensure new products are executable without unnecessary complexityIdentify and drive improvements that reduce rework, improve efficiency, and elevate overall build qualityImplement structured product development processes including milestone tracking and review gatesHold teams accountable for timelines, deliverables, and executionDrive urgency and remove bottlenecks within the development pipelineMaintain visibility into project status, risks, and key decisionsPartner with production, quality, supply chain, and customer service to support the businessEnsure engineering is responsive to real product issues and continuous improvement needsSupport product launches with sales and marketing to ensure strong alignment and executionQualificationsRequired QualificationsProven track record leading product development from concept through production launchExperience managing Engineering teams and delivering complex, high-quality productsStrong understanding of marine product design, performance, and real-world useBachelor's degree in Engineering from an ABET accredited university (Mechanical, Marine, Ocean, Electrical, or Naval Architecture)Preferred QualificationsABYC certification or strong working knowledge of marine standardsProfessional certifications such as PE, CPM, or PMPPassion for boating, fishing, and the marine industryWhat Will Make You Stand OutYou have a genuine connection to the marine industry and spend time on boatsYou take ownership of outcomes and hold your team accountableYou can balance strong Engineering fundamentals with practical executionYou build strong relationships across teams, especially with operationsYou bring energy, urgency, and a bias for actionThis role is an opportunity to shape the future of MBG products and build a team that takes pride in what we put on the water. The right person for this role understands that great boats are not just designed, they are experienced.
